Orpington Ducks.
Are you thinking about keeping a rare breed but finding it hard to choose which one?
 
When it comes to husbandry and upkeep, a pure breed takes no more effort than a cross-breed.
 
The Orpington Duck is included on the Rare Breeds Survival Trust (RBST)‘s watchlist of traditional breeds of poultry. In recent years, the number of Orpingtons being kept has declined. The RBST considers this to be one of the duck breeds at greatest risk of being lost.
